I think javadocs are not 100% correct. I am pretty sure exception will be thrown if connection to some node cannot be established, but if node A already have active connections to all nodes you want to send message to then message will be put to per-connection queues and will be sent in async manner.
I think you can introduce new method that waits until message is acked from all nodes or throws exception if any of the target nodes leave.
